Abstract

An individual secure computation server apparatus in a secure computation system computes, by using a cyclic permutation shared by secure computation server apparatuses except one of the secure computation server apparatuses, a value of a cyclic permutation for the one secure computation server apparatus, performs a fraud detection by performing an equality check on values of cyclic permutations computed by the other secure computation server apparatuses, constitutes a random cyclic permutation by synthesizing the cyclic permutations, applies the random cyclic permutation to a share in a sequence, computes a share which indicates an index and to which the random cyclic permutation has been applied by adding a share having a shift amount of the cyclic permutation to the share which indicates the index, reconstructs the share which indicates the index and to which the random cyclic permutation has been applied, and selects the share corresponding to the index.
